Hi, and welcome aboard. This Thursday we run the quarterly disaster-recovery drill for Splitgate, our A/B experiment assignment service. We will fail over the assignment cache to the Harrowfen region, verify that bucket hashes remain deterministic, and confirm exposure logging resumes within five minutes. Please shadow Tomasz through the runbook and note any unclear steps. Should the standby vault be sealed when we start, unseal it using the recovery passphrase provided directly below.

unlock words, fafop-hawep: briwyn-oliix-sorox

## Step 4 — Enabling Offline Mode for Marshlark Field Survey

Before shipping the offline-capable build, confirm the local cache is encrypted at rest and that sync conflict resolution never silently drops surveyor edits. Review the bundled tile data for embedded credentials — none should exist. The offline package is sealed and signed at build time; reviewers should validate the seal against the key below.

release key, yagap-kagag: bky6_1ks93y

As the security reviewer, note that compression happens after field-level redaction, so no plaintext identifiers should reach the compression stage. Packthistle accepts only mutually authenticated traffic from collectors, and its admin API is restricted to the review VLAN. To exercise the admin endpoints during your assessment, you will need the internal service credential, which is provided immediately below for the duration of the review.

gateway credential: kto23_LX9A4ys6i4nzHtpOLNLodKK

- [ ] Step 7: Archive cold storage buckets (Glacierline tier). Confirm both ceremony witnesses are present, verify bucket manifests match the Oxbow ledger, then seal the archive key shares. Plugin authors may observe but not handle shares. Once sealed, the archive index itself is encrypted and can only be reopened with the passphrase below.

vault phrase of badup-hahig = tamael-aldael-kelmir-istael-fenok-istwyn-tamius-jorath-oliion

## Authentication

Hey, welcome to the Hueproof crew! Our contrast-audit runner hits the internal Palettecheck service to pull WCAG thresholds and store audit results. You'll need a service key before the runner will do anything useful — without it you'll just get a grumpy 401. Keys are scoped per environment, so grab the dev one first. For local setup, use the key provided below.

service key, fawip-bajef: kto11_Qt5wZK9vdNC